Behchoko man arrested for near child abduction

Behchoko RCMP have arrested one man following an attempted child abduction in the community. 

On Friday morning, police say two children were walking on a wooded path near Elizabeth Mackenzie Elementary School when an unknown man grabbed one of the children and tried to drag them into the woods.

The child was able to break free from the suspect and run to safety with the other child.

Following an investigation, police arrested one man on Friday night. His identity hasn’t been released but RCMP say charges are pending.

“This incident brings forward the opportunity to remind parents and guardians to speak to children and youth about personal safety,” said RCMP in a statement.

Police say parents should discuss a safety plan with their children in the event of a similar incident.
